Immfly, an in-flight entertainment specialist, has received an undisclosed investment from Boeing.
The exact amount has not been revealed, but a spokesperson confirms it was in the "double digit" millions.
The investment in Immfly comes via the aircraft manufacturer's venture arm, Boeing HorizonX, and is expected to help it boost capabilities for its airline customers.
Immfly’s technology enables carriers to manage in-flight entertainment, flight information, advertising and onboard sales.
The company’s executive chairman, Jimmy Martinez von Korff, says the companies have a “common vision” to help airlines improve the onboard experience and find new revenue streams.
According to a release, Immfly is one of four companies that Boeing has invested in outside the United States, including U.K-based Reaction Engines, a hypersonic flight specialist.
